Latest Patents

Cohen's latest patents include a system for personalized hearing profile generation with real-time feedback. This invention involves an ear-level device equipped with a memory, microphone, speaker, and processor. It establishes communication with a companion device that features a user interface. The system allows users to create a personalized hearing profile by interacting with a frame of reference in the user interface, which is linked to sound profile data. The device generates sound based on the audio stream data, providing real-time feedback to the user. Another significant patent is for an earpiece with a voice menu. This ear-level device operates in multiple modes and supports a voice menu that enables users to select complex functions through simple input. By pressing a button, users can activate a voice menu that announces various functions, such as voice dialing and last number redial.
